This was our last full week on the job, sort of. Monday and Tuesday Stu and Wayne finished off all the second fix carpentry, including the stairs, in the nice and warm. We also had Dean the electrician on site carrying out his second fix works, while Tony who we are working for set about tiling the bathroom floor and all the walls. On the Tuesday I was relegated to working outside in the cold and rain, making good the garden area. I set about marking out and profiling a new replacement path, so we could get the concrete in on Wednesday when it was supposed to be a nice sunny day.
It was nice and sunny on the Wednesday, and we duly got the concrete path laid. We then proceeded to level the garden area and put down 20mm gravel as requested. On the Thursday we make good some damage to the drive where the skip lorry had put down its support legs, and also make good the entrance area to the extension. We also cleared the site of most of our materials and tools, taking the concrete mixer and scaffold boards to our next work site in preparation for our start there in a few weeks time.
As it was Wayne’s last day, we were very kindly treated to some bacon butties and a nice cup of tea. In the afternoon we walked through every room in the extension and produced a snagging list of all the little jobs that needed to be done so everything could be signed off as finished. Fortunately most of the list was made up of areas on the walls that needed some filler to make them good. We were going to fit the bathroom furniture so we could be all finished this week, but unfortunately the client is having problems with getting the furniture delivered, so we will have to pop back in a week’s time and do it then, if everything is delivered!
